| Visited twice when cruising the Cheshire Ring. Excellent Taylors Landlord on our first visit. 2nd (Friday) visit disappointed - no real ale available for 24 hours (barrels still settling) so we left to quench our thirsty crew elsewhere. MG_the_beerhunter - 28 Sep 2008 18:41 |
A sign outside read “Under New Management”, which showed, as the staff were trying really hard to please. Lovely beer garden overlooking Kings Lock, on the Trent and Mersey canal. We sampled 5 different meals, including Sunday Lunch, and it was quite good. The pub was let down by selling Greene King’s appalling I.P.A. pubinspectors - 10 Oct 2007 09:07 |
